Vendors are supposed to charge sales tax on items sold via the Net if they matain a presene with the state that the order is placed.

If you pick up an item from a B&M then that would require sales tax (if exists) because the vendor must have a presense (for you to recieve it).

Most states also ask you to declare items that you purchased and do not pay sales tax on via your yearly tax forms.
